Conversion formula
The conversion factor from grams to kilograms is 0.001, which means that 1 gram is equal to 0.001 kilograms:
1 g = 0.001 kg
To convert 1992 grams into kilograms we have to multiply 1992 by the conversion factor in order to get the mass amount from grams to kilograms.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 g → 0.001 kg
1992 g → M(kg)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the mass M in kilograms:
M(kg) = 1992 g × 0.001 kg
M(kg) = 1.992 kg
The final result is:
1992 g → 1.992 kg
We conclude that 1992 grams is equivalent to 1.992 kilograms:
1992 grams = 1.992 kilograms
